It's generally the a$$hole answer, Priority, but I think it's appropriate here: if you really don't like the thread topic, don't read it and don't participate...

I think the mods should be more concerned with watching the sorts of thread titles (language, etc) we have and making sure we have no spam more than trying to stop something like last night. I think a few of us wanted to "play" and we did. Tonight might be a different story...

The fact that so many of us were responding probably indicates that it shouldn't have been stopped. If, on the other hand, he had continued to bring his own post to the top without any response, then that's when the mods need to step in. In other words, while he was annoying, I don't think he was really doing anything wrong or against board rules. And when I'd had enough, I quit reading and quit responding...

I think things worked out just fine. I was as bad as anyone, maybe worse, at feeding those trolls last night. But I believe it was a little different than the usual "chiefs suck" troll. While I disagreed (as you can see from the post) with them, they did bring up a valid point. I don't believe it pertains to the Chiefs, but I could see a problem with "Redskins"...what made them trolls was the constant spinning and failure to respond to simple questions. I would hate to see over moderation on this board. I would rather have to take a little troll occasionally than be thought of as a board that only allows agreeing viewpoints.

I don't think we need more moderators, if some of us weren't feeding them for our own entertainment, they would have gone away. This board is in great shape, has a good community of posters, and is getting better everyday.

About Last Night...

Wasn't that a movie? Anyway, I personally don't think we need more moderators <I>yet</I>. In fact, I saw a lot of positives resulting from Planet's first Troll Raid:

1. This BB absorbed it without even blinking. Never slowed down once.

2. The board gave him every opportunity (and then some) to explain his position. Free speech in an open forum at its best.

3. As Gaz implied, members had numerous options: ignore feature, respond with counter-smaque, attempt to engage him in rational discussion, or read other posts. I personally did a combo: politely asked him 3 times to explain his position; my 4th post warned him (as did 3 other members), then I let fly on #5 with recipes. I had fun (still need to "counsel Cody though!).

4. Someone mentioned that it was kinda like the Phil Henry show...couldn't agree more. It was obvious to me that Falstaff / Pearlman / Sybil was trying to merely push buttons. He / they / she succeeded with some people, and that's OK too.

5. I don't see where Falstaff "spammed" the BB. He stayed within the thread (and was <B>abused</B>). Now if he started pulling that Campaign For Sanity crap, I'd be the first one reporting him to a moderator for spamming, although the Recipe Maneuver has been quite effective on Pigskin too.

6. Wouldn't mind doing that again next week. But after the season starts, I have no use for it, except maybe during the bye.
